Different Types of Green Traffic Cones

Not all of them are created equal. Here are some of their types:

  1. Standard: These are the most common and widely used, ideal for general road safety and construction sites.
  2. Reflective: Equipped with reflective materials, these cones enhance visibility during nighttime or low-light conditions.
  3. Collapsible: Portable and space-saving, these cones are perfect for emergency situations and temporary road closures.
  4. Weighted Base: Designed for stability, these cones are perfect for windy conditions as well as offer increased resistance to tipping over.
  5. Slim Profile: These slender cones are suitable for narrow roadways and areas with limited space.

Proper Placement and Maintenance

Here’s what you need to know:

Correct Placement Techniques:

  1. Ensure cones are spaced appropriately to guide drivers safely.
  2. Place them in a linear or zigzag pattern depending on the situation.
  3. Consider weather conditions and terrain for stable positioning.
  4. Use cones to mark potential hazards, construction areas, or road closures effectively.

Maintenance and Storage:

  1. Regularly inspect cones for damage, wear, or fading.
  2. Clean cones as needed to maintain visibility.
  3. Repair or replace damaged cones promptly to ensure safety.
  4. Store cones in a dry, cool place to prevent deterioration and deformation.
